11 May, 2026Executive summary
Transformation strategy emphasizes a shift from commodity to high-margin, non-display products, leveraging technology, optimizing assets, and expanding into smart cockpit solutions through the Pioneer acquisition.
CarUX and Pioneer integration aims to deliver a comprehensive in-car experience, expanding manufacturing and customer base while maintaining organizational structure and brand.
InnoCare and the Group focus on product mix optimization, emerging market expansion, and technology leadership in IGZO sensors.
Consolidated financial statements for 2025 and 2024 were audited and present fairly in all material respects in accordance with IFRS as endorsed in Taiwan.
Key audit matters included inventory valuation, impairment of property, plant and equipment and goodwill, and purchase price allocation for the Pioneer acquisition.
Financial highlights
2025 net sales reached NT$226,724 million, up 4.7% year-over-year; 4Q25 net sales were NT$56,742 million, down 1.9% sequentially.
Net profit attributable to owners dropped sharply to NT$665 million (or $249,764 thousand) in 2025, a 90.1% decrease year-over-year; 4Q25 net profit was NT$66 million.
EBITDA for 2025 was NT$25,561 million, up 10% year-over-year; 4Q25 EBITDA was NT$6,396 million.
Basic EPS for 2025 was NT$0.03, compared to NT$0.76 in 2024.
Gross margin for 2025 was 8.2%, down from 10.1% in 2024.
Outlook and guidance
2026 panel area demand expected to grow 6% year-over-year, led by ultra-large sizes; TV and monitor prices expected to remain resilient in Q2, while notebook and mobile phone segments face year-over-year declines.
Continued focus on high-margin, non-commodity, and non-display businesses, with Fan-Out PLP and CarUX as long-term growth drivers.
Fan-Out PLP mass production ongoing; RDL and TGV client certifications targeted within two years.
Naked-eye 3D display markets forecast strong CAGR: smart gaming monitors 80%, smart notebooks 83%.
InnoCare plans further expansion in India, Africa, and Americas, leveraging local manufacturing and service models.
